<p class="CULTURE3linedrop">In most movie westerns, an appaloosa is a horse. But the title of his new revisionist oater, Ed Harris’ first outing in the director’s chair since <em>Pollock</em>, refers to a town where, as one wag at last week’s dull Toronto International Film Festival observed, “men are men and women are … Renée Zellweger.” It went over with a thud there, but in retrospect, considering all the pretentious bores surrounding it, it’s beginning to look good. <span class='read-more'><a href="http://www.observer.com/2008/arts-culture/sweet-ren-e-apple-cheeked-wedge-between-two-saddle-bums">&nbsp;read&nbsp;more&nbsp;&raquo;</a></span></p>]]></description>
